Subject: DR drill recap — PuzzleForge

Hi all, quick notes for the sync. We ran the quarterly disaster-recovery drill on PuzzleForge, our crossword generator, simulating total loss of the grid-template store. Restore from cold backup took 41 minutes — better than last quarter but the dictionary shards still lagged. Action items: automate shard warming, and fix the runbook step that pointed at the retired Oakmere cluster. One reminder: restoring the sealed config archive still requires manually entering the recovery passphrase below.

unlock words, yawig-kagef: gordor-holvan-ulaael-pramir-ulaiel-tamdor

Ticket: Signature check failing on the Routewise driver-assignment heuristic build. Pipeline rejects the artifact every time, even after a clean rebuild — looks like the verification step is still using the retired key from the Janფ— January rotation. Support folks, please point affected users at the updated verification key below.

signing key of bagap-yawep = bky13_TbfT6ZMUoGJo2

Subject: Pooler key rotation tonight — heads up

Hey, quick note before your shift: we're rotating the credential for Tapwell, the connection pooler sitting in front of the analytics cluster. The old key gets revoked at 02:00, so if you see a burst of auth failures around then, that's expected — just confirm services reconnect within a minute or two. Staging already rotated cleanly this afternoon. Runbook steps are unchanged; only the secret itself is new. For tonight's manual checks, the replacement key is below.

gateway credential: kto23_LX9A4ys6i4nzHtpOLNLodKK

Flagging for the release notes: this change makes the Mailvane bounce processor classify soft bounces with a sliding window instead of a flat counter, so suppression timing shifts slightly. Behavior is gated behind a config flag and defaults off until the next train. No schema changes; safe to hotfix-revert. The window and threshold constants going out with this build are:

constants for bawif-kawif:
QUOTAS = {
    "ulaael": 5,
    "holael": 10,
}